NDA to Fight Tripura Village Committee Polls on Local Issues: Ratan Nath

AGARTALA, SEPTEMBER 8: The BJP-led NDA in Tripura will approach the upcoming Village Committee elections as a united alliance, with development issues at the local level expected to form the centre of its campaign, Power and Agriculture Minister Ratan Lal Nath said on Monday.

Nath said the alliance comprising the BJP, Tipra Motha and IPFT was confident of securing between 90 and 95 per cent of the seats in the elections. He maintained that changing political preferences in the state had shown that no constituency could be treated as a permanent stronghold.

The Village Committee polls will be held across 52 of Tripura’s 58 blocks, covering 587 villages and 4,597 seats. Nath said the scale of the elections made coordination among alliance partners essential.

According to the minister, the NDA partners have agreed to contest the elections jointly rather than functioning as separate political entities. Seat-sharing was worked out taking into account the results of the previous elections to the Tripura Tribal Areas Autonomous District Council, he said.

Nath said discussions involving Union Home Minister Amit Shah, Chief Minister Manik Saha and representatives of Tipra Motha in Delhi helped address differences over seat-sharing. He said the discussions continued for around 10 to 12 hours before an understanding was reached, with local leaders asked to settle outstanding issues through dialogue.

He said the alliance would focus its campaign on issues directly affecting villagers, including drinking water, roads and implementation of welfare schemes. In constituencies where both BJP and Tipra Motha have organisational strength, the partners could exchange seats based on local considerations, he said.

Talks on such adjustments are already taking place in areas including Kalyanpur and Raima Valley, Nath added.

The minister also referred to the changing electoral landscape in Tripura, particularly in the tribal areas. He claimed that the CPI(M) had failed to win a seat in the state’s 20 tribal Assembly constituencies in both the 2018 and 2023 elections, describing it as an indication of the decline of the Left’s traditional influence.

Nath further appealed to the State Election Commission to ensure that candidates who reach nomination centres before the deadline are allowed to complete the filing process even if scrutiny extends beyond the prescribed evening hours.

He rejected CPI(M) allegations regarding difficulties in filing nominations, alleging that the opposition party was staying away from parts of the contest because of limited electoral prospects.

With the three alliance partners preparing to campaign together, Nath said the NDA was positioned to make a strong showing in the Village Committee elections and consolidate its political presence at the grassroots level.
